Samsung's name is at the forefront of the foldable smartphone. In the year 2019, with its first foldable smartphone, Samsung Galaxy Fold, the company dominated the market. The company has so far launched its four generations of foldable smartphones. Currently, the company is preparing to launch the upcoming foldable phones Galaxy Z Fold 5 and Z Flip 5 these days.
If media reports are to be believed, Samsung's upcoming foldable phone home market could be unveiled at the Samsung Galaxy Unpacked 2023 event to be held later this month in South Korea. Ahead of the launch, alleged pictures of Samsung's upcoming Galaxy Z Fold 5 have surfaced.
Changes in the design of Galaxy Z Fold 5
Some alleged pictures of the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 5 were shared on Twitter, which were removed shortly. These photos show that the company has made a lot of improvements in its design and hinge.
The company has so far launched four generations of Samsung Galaxy Z Fold. Despite this, the phone did not turn off completely. The image of this phone that was revealed shows that the upcoming Galaxy Z Fold 5 is completely shutting down.
At the moment it is not known whether this updated hinge will be installed only in Galaxy Z Fold 5 or it will be used in Galaxy Z Flip 5 as well. Samsung has been struggling with the problem of the hinge and display crease of its foldable smartphone series since the beginning.
Features of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 5 (Potential)
The upcoming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 5 smartphone is expected to be launched with Qualcomm's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 processor. Along with this, the company is doing a lot of work on its hinge and design. Along with this, there is also a big challenge in front of Samsung to keep the price of the phone low.
